When dealing with slurry, you generally want to go bigger and slower. The thicker the impeller, the better it will hold up. The slower the pump, the less erosion will inflict on the impeller. However, the impeller isn’t the only thing to worry in slurry pump when dealing with slurry. Tough, durable materials of construction are necessary most of the time. Metal slurry pump liners and wear plates are common in slurry applications.

Read MoreDepending on the abrasive nature of the slurry, it is important to select the ideal seal. Slurry pump seals should have a hardened surface made of silicon carbide or tungsten carbide. Vortex pumps use patented seal technology that utilizes a double mechanical seal setup and a separate seal flushing system. This allows the sealing surface to be kept cool at all times without causing the slurry to overheat the seal and crack the surface.

- What we mean by slurry is basically a liquid containing solid particles. When you want to pump this slurry, there are different requirements than when pumping only dirty water. A waste water pump cannot handle the solid particles of a slurry. This is where slurry pumps come in handy. >Slurry pumps are heavy duty and robust versions of centrifugal pumps, capable of handling tough and abrasive tasks.

>Slurry pump impeller is one of the most important parts of centrifugal slurry pumps. Depending on the application, slurry pump impeller selection is crucial to slurry pump performance. Slurry applications can be especially hard on the impeller of slurry pumps because of their abrasive nature. In order slurry pumps operates efficiently and stand up to the test of time, impeller has to be selected properly for slurry pumps.

Choosing the right location for your access panel is crucial. Use a stud finder to ensure you are not placing the panel over a ceiling joist, which would make it impossible to cut through. Once you find a suitable spot, use a measuring tape to mark the outline of the access panel on the ceiling where you intend to install it. Ensure that the panel does not interfere with existing light fixtures or ventilation systems.
